Vue 20 - “v-once“

Vue框架的v-once是一个指令,它告诉Vue只渲染元素和组件一次,不管后续的数据变化如何。使用v-once可以提高性能,因为它避免了不必要的重渲染。

使用v-once很简单,只需要将它添加到你想要渲染一次的元素或组件上即可:


<div v-once>
  这个div只会被渲染一次
</div>

需要注意的是,使用v-once指令将使元素或组件及其所有的子元素都只渲染一次。如果数据发生了变化,它们将不会被更新。

因此,v-once通常用于渲染不会发生变化的内容,例如静态文本或者静态图片等。

猜你喜欢

转载自blog.csdn.net/m0_53753920/article/details/130033662